install-deps.sh: do not install libpmem from chacra #46773

this change reverts 17d2bc3, before
we recreate a chacra repo hosting libpmem packages, we are not able
to query the repo from shaman or pull the dependencies from chacra.

in future, we should be able to get the libpmem dependencies from
offical ubuntu package repo and fedora, CentOS Stream and RHEL repos.

The backport to quincy failed:

The process '/usr/bin/git' failed with exit code 128

To backport manually, run these commands in your terminal:

# Fetch latest updates from GitHub
git fetch
# Create a new working tree
git worktree add .worktrees/backport-quincy quincy
# Navigate to the new working tree
cd .worktrees/backport-quincy
# Create a new branch
git switch --create backport-46773-to-quincy
# Cherry-pick the merged commit of this pull request and resolve the conflicts
git cherry-pick -x --mainline 1 2679a1e0f42284e7d60a59067c4a56194c696ba0
# Push it to GitHub
git push --set-upstream origin backport-46773-to-quincy
# Go back to the original working tree
cd ../..
# Delete the working tree
git worktree remove .worktrees/backport-quincy

Then, create a pull request where the base branch is quincy and the compare/head branch is backport-46773-to-quincy.
